Mechanism of Action
Laser therapy utilizes low-level lasers or light-emitting diodes to stimulate cellular processes. When you receive treatment, the light penetrates your skin and is absorbed by your cells, especially the mitochondria. This absorption boosts ATP manufacturing, which is the power currency of your cells. As a result, your cells can fix themselves quicker and effectively.
In addition, cold laser therapy advertises enhanced blood flow, providing more oxygen and nutrients to broken tissues. It also helps reduce swelling and discomfort by regulating the launch of various biochemical substances.
Therapy Process Review
When you undergo cold laser therapy, a qualified expert directs low-level laser light onto the targeted area of your body. This non-invasive treatment generally lasts between 15 to thirty minutes, relying on your problem and the location being dealt with. You may really feel a gentle heat or prickling sensation, however the procedure is typically painless.
The laser light penetrates your skin, boosting cellular activity and advertising recovery. Sessions are usually scheduled multiple times a week for optimum outcomes, and you may observe renovations after simply a few treatments.
After each session, you can usually resume your everyday activities without any downtime, making it a hassle-free option for those seeking remedy for pain or inflammation.

Safety And Security and Side Effects of Cold Laser Treatment
While cold laser therapy is typically considered safe, it's important to be aware of potential adverse effects. Lots of people experience very little pain, however you might observe short-term skin inflammation or a feeling of heat during treatment.
Hardly ever, some individuals report frustrations or dizziness after sessions. If you're sensitive to light or have particular clinical conditions, review this with your doctor prior to starting treatment.
Additionally, make certain the professional is qualified and uses FDA-approved tools. Although severe side effects are unusual, it's a good idea to check your body's response after each session.
If you experience any type of unusual signs and symptoms, don't wait to reach out to your medical professional for guidance. Being educated helps make sure a favorable experience with cold laser treatment.
